Itogon Welcomes Baguio Athletes for CARAA meet 2025

PIO ITOGON February 22, 2025

Itogon proudly hosts Baguio City’s Cordillera Administrative Region Athletic Association (CARAA) 2025 welcome program, welcoming over 815 delegates on February 22, 2025, at Lucban Integrated School.

With the theme “Fostering a United and Healthier Cordillera through Sports,” Itogon welcomed 583 athletes, including 138 coaches, 79 members of the technical working group, and 14 city officials.

Hon. Bernard S. Waclin expressed his support for the event, highlighting the importance of sports development. “We participate because kayat tayo met nga maimprove ‘ti sports iti probinsya tayo… Agay-ayam tao nga adda ‘ti ragsak ken ayat.” (We participate because we want to improve sports in our community. Let us play with joy and love.)

The crowd roared with excitement during the welcome program, led by Dr. Soraya T. Faculo, PhD, CESO VI, Schools Division Superintendent and delegation head, alongside honorary guests Hon. Benjamin B. Magalong, Mayor of Baguio City, and Hon. Mark Go, Congressman of Baguio City.

According to Dr. Faculo, the largest delegation hails from Baguio City, known as the “E-Lions,” boosted by their unifying cheer, “One team, one roar, one victory!”

The event was also attended by Itogon Vice Mayor Dante Alain Xavier Godio, Baguio City Councilor Vladimir Cayabas, and Itogon Councilors Norberto Pacio, Clint Galutan, Alejandro Palangdan, Indigenous People’s Mandatory Representative (IPMR) Ernani Pis-oy, and Sangguniang Kabataan Federation (SKF) President Judbert Alicnas.

Although the welcome program was held at Lucban Integrated School in Baguio City, Itogon proudly embraced its role as the host municipality.

To conclude the event, tokens of appreciation were awarded to recognize the invaluable contributions of the athletes, coaches, parents, and esteemed guests.

The parade and opening program will be on February 23, 2025 and run until February 28, 2025 drawing athletes and sports enthusiasts from across the region.

Let the games begin!
